The South-eastern Side of Portions of a Road in the County of Waitaki exempted from the Provisions of Section 128 of the Public Works Act, 1928, subject to a Condition as to the Building-line.
GALWAY, Governor-General.
ORDER IN COUNCIL.
At the Government House at Wellington, this 28th day of August, 1935.
Present:
HIS EXCELLENCY THE GOVERNOR-GENERAL IN COUNCIL.
IN pursuance and exercise of the powers conferred by the Public Works Act, 1928, and of all other powers in anywise enabling him in this behalf, His Excellency the Governor-General of the Dominion of New Zealand, acting by and with the advice and consent of the Executive Council of the said Dominion, doth hereby approve of the following resolution passed by the Waitaki County Council on the twenty-fifth day of August, one thousand nine hundred and thirty-three, viz. :—
“ That the Waitaki County Council, being the local authority having control of the roads in the Waitaki County, by resolution declares that the provisions of section one hundred and twenty-eight of the Public Works Act, 1928, shall not apply to the southern side of the public road abutting on part Section 114 and on Section 564R, Block II, Otepopo Survey District ”;
subject to the condition that no building or part of a building shall at any time be erected on the land fronting the south-eastern side of the portions of road (described in the Schedule hereto) within a distance of thirty-three feet from the centre-line of the said portions of road.
SCHEDULE.
THE south-eastern side of all those portions of road, situated in the Otago Land District, County of Waitaki, fronting parts Sections 114 and 564R, Block II, Otepopo Survey District. As the said portions of road are more particularly delineated on the plan marked P.W.D. 90043, deposited in the office of the Minister of Public Works at Wellington, and thereon coloured red.

The South-eastern Side of Portion of Grange Street, in the City of Dunedin, exempted from the Provisions of Section 128 of the Public Works Act, 1928, subject to a Condition as to the Building-line.
GALWAY, Governor-General.
ORDER IN COUNCIL.
At the Government House at Wellington, this 28th day of August, 1935.
Present:
HIS EXCELLENCY THE GOVERNOR-GENERAL IN COUNCIL.
IN pursuance and exercise of the powers conferred by the Public Works Act, 1928, and of all other powers in any-wise enabling him in this behalf, His Excellency the Governor-General of the Dominion of New Zealand, acting by and with the advice and consent of the Executive Council of the said Dominion, doth hereby approve of the following resolution passed by the Dunedin City Council on the twenty-second day of July, one thousand nine hundred and thirty-five, viz. :—
“ That the Dunedin City Council, being the local authority having control of the streets in the City of Dunedin, by resolution declares that the provisions of section one hundred and twenty-eight of the Public Works Act, 1928, shall not apply to portion of the south-eastern side of Grange Street, in the said City of Dunedin, where such portion of street abuts on Lot 16, L.T.P. 24, being part Section 23, Block XXII, Town of Dunedin, as the said portion of street is more particularly shown on the plan annexed hereto and is thereon coloured brown and edged with red to its centre-line ”;
subject to the condition that no building or part of a building shall at any time be erected on the land fronting the south-eastern side of the portion of Grange Street (described in the Schedule hereto) within a distance of thirty-three feet from the centre-line of the said portion of street.
SCHEDULE.
THE south-eastern side of all that portion of street, situated in the Otago Land District, City of Dunedin, known as Grange Street, fronting Lot 16, L.T.P. 24, being part Section 23, Block XXII, Town of Dunedin. As the said portion of street is more particularly delineated on the plan marked P.W.D. 89964, deposited in the office of the Minister of Public Works at Wellington, and thereon edged red.

The South-western Side of Portion of Carlyle Street, in the City of Dunedin, exempted from the Provisions of Section 128 of the Public Works Act, 1928, subject to a Condition as to the Building-line.
GALWAY, Governor-General.
ORDER IN COUNCIL.
At the Government House at Wellington, this 28th day of August, 1935.
Present:
HIS EXCELLENCY THE GOVERNOR-GENERAL IN COUNCIL.
IN pursuance and exercise of the powers conferred by the Public Works Act, 1928, and of all other powers in anywise enabling him in this behalf, His Excellency the Governor-General of the Dominion of New Zealand, acting by and with the advice and consent of the Executive Council of the said Dominion, doth hereby approve of the following resolution passed by the Dunedin City Council on the twenty-second day of July, one thousand nine hundred and thirty-five, viz. :—
“ That the Dunedin City Council, being the local authority having control of the streets in the City of Dunedin, by resolution declares that the provisions of section one hundred and twenty-eight of the Public Works Act, 1928, shall not apply to portion of the south-western side of Carlyle Street, in the said City of Dunedin, where such portion of street abuts on Lots 71, 72, 73, and 74, Township of Ferguslie, as the said portion of street is more particularly shown on the plan annexed hereto and is thereon coloured brown and edged with red to its centre-line ”;
subject to the condition that no building or part of a building shall at any time be erected on the land fronting the south-western side of the portion of Carlyle Street (described in the Schedule hereto) within a distance of thirty-three feet from the centre-line of the said portion of street.
SCHEDULE.
THE south-western side of all that portion of street, situated in the Otago Land District, City of Dunedin, known as Carlyle Street, fronting Lots 71, 72, 73, and 74, Township of Ferguslie. As the said portion of street is more particularly delineated on the plan marked P.W.D. 89965, deposited in the office of the Minister of Public Works at Wellington, and thereon edged red.
